Technological Innovations Powering Mobile Gaming
Several technological advancements have converged to create the mobile gaming revolution. These innovations have not only improved the user experience but have also expanded the range of games and features available to players. The following are some of the most significant:
- HTML5 Technology: This has enabled the development of cross-platform compatible games, ensuring seamless gameplay across various devices and operating systems.
- Responsive Design: Websites and applications are now designed to adapt to different screen sizes and resolutions, providing an optimal viewing experience on smartphones and tablets.
- Advanced Graphics and Processing Power: Modern mobile devices boast powerful processors and high-resolution displays, allowing for visually stunning games with smooth animations and realistic graphics.
- Improved Connectivity: The widespread availability of high-speed internet, including 4G and 5G networks, ensures a stable and reliable gaming experience, even on the go.

Regulatory Landscape in Canada
The regulation of online gambling in Canada is a complex and evolving landscape. Each province and territory has the authority to regulate online gambling within its borders. This decentralized approach has led to a patchwork of regulations, with varying levels of oversight and enforcement. The legal status of online casinos also differs across provinces. Some provinces, like Ontario, have established regulated online gambling markets, while others operate under different frameworks. Understanding the specific regulations in each province is crucial for operators and players alike.
The Kahnawake Gaming Commission, located in Quebec, is a prominent licensing and regulatory body for online gambling operators. The commission licenses and regulates numerous online casinos that serve the Canadian market. The regulatory framework aims to protect players, ensure fair gaming practices, and prevent money laundering. Compliance with these regulations is essential for operators to maintain their licenses and operate legally within Canada.
